Shorrock Automation has Wago distributorship
February 2005
News
Shorrock Automation, a leading supplier of process control and factory automation products has gained the Wago distributorship.
Based in Germany, Wago launched the cage clamp connection technology some 25 years ago. Since then, it has become an industrial standard worldwide and connection technology would be unthinkable without it. As the inventor of the spring pressure termination technology, Wago is a specialist in manufacturing electrical and electronic components that utilise spring pressure termination technology. The company relies on innovative connection systems to develop electronic subsystems as well as electrical connectors. Shorrock Automation will be marketing Wago's wide range of PCB terminal blocks, modular I/O systems, electronic and signal conditioning modules.
Shorrock Automation's other existing product ranges include the IFM Electronic industrial networking systems and comprehensive range of positioning and fluid instrumentation, Woodhead Connectivity's cables and industrial Ethernet equipment, as well as Reer's safety light barriers, Shorrock Automation is now really able to offer its clients in the process control industry a total one-shop service.
